## Restock Planner Hooks

Plugins for the Slotwren restock planner register via the manifest file; one hook per machine route. Keep hook handlers idempotent — the planner retries on timeout. Inventory deltas must be posted within 30 seconds of invocation or the slot is skipped. All plugin calls to the Coilbank inventory service require auth. Initialize your plugin client with the key below.

API key for yahig-tadup: kto7_ubizbYm

Treasury presented exposure arising from the Valdoria expansion, noting that roughly a third of next year's receivables will be denominated in foreign currency. After discussion of forward contracts versus natural hedging through local procurement, management approved a rolling twelve-month forward programme covering 70% of forecast exposure, reviewed quarterly. Sales leads should quote in local currency only where Treasury confirms cover. The confidential note on broader plans appears below.

board note of kageg-bahof: The renewal with Holwynax Holdings closes at $2 million a year, 5 percent below the last contract. Project Ulaath slips by two quarters because of the supplier delay.

Welcome to the Shelfwright on-call rotation! The nightly catalogue import pulls MARC records from the Brindlewood Library consortium and stages them before merge. If the import stalls, check the staging tables first — nine times out of ten it's a duplicate accession number. To inspect the staging database directly, connect using the string below.

primary connection of tajeg-tajop = postgresql://julax_svc:DI@db-e7f3.kelvidyn.corp:5432/rusdor

Handover Note — Product-Line Retirement

To the incoming director: the Varnell Aerotrim line will be retired by end of Q3. Manufacturing at the Dellbrook plant winds down in June; remaining inventory ships to distributors under existing terms. Marenda Holt is coordinating customer notifications and the spare-parts commitment, which runs eighteen months. Open items are logged in the transition tracker. The strategic rationale and next steps are summarised below.

internal memo for faweg-tafog: Only 7 of the 100 pilot accounts renewed Quenael, so a churn review is set for April 15.